Short Bio

Prof. Hila May, PhD, is an Associate Professor at the Gray Faculty of Medical and Health Sciences, Tel Aviv University, where she directs the Biohistory and Evolutionary Medicine Laboratory. She is also the head of the Dan David Center for Human Evolution and Biohistory Research and serves as Chair of the Department of Anatomy and Biological Anthropology. 

Prof. May earned her BSc, MSc, and PhD at Tel Aviv University and completed postdoctoral training at the Institute of Evolutionary Medicine, University of Zurich, Switzerland.  

Prof. May is a specialist in biological and virtual anthropology; she uses cutting-edge imaging techniques to reconstruct ancient populations’ origin, behavior, diet, and health from skeletal remains. Her work in evolutionary medicine reveals etiological factors for today’s most common musculoskeletal disorders, paving the way for personalized preventive strategies. She is also a field anthropologist of various excavations - from Middle Paleolithic sites to Byzantine cemeteries.
